Change your password to be able to log in to the student web

A security measure following the cyber-attack on 2 May is that all students and staff must change their passwords. If you haven't changed your password since 7 May, you need to do so in order to log in to the student web.

If you have changed your password after that date, you do not need to do anything. You can log in as usual.

Higher security when logging into Ladok

From 5 December 2023, you need to have confirmed your Umu-id to log into Ladok if you have a Swedish personal identity number.
